Title :
Diversity order analysis of a sub-optimal transmit antenna selection strategy for non-regenerative MIMO relay channel

Abstract :
This paper proposes a novel sub-optimal transmit antenna selection (TAS) strategy for non-regenerative half-duplex MIMO relay channel. While antenna selection is a sub-optimal form of beamforming, it still enjoys the advantage of tractable optimization and low feedback overhead. The diversity order of this proposed strategy is derived to prove that it can achieve the full diversity order as the optimal strategy with only a small performance loss. Furthermore, it is shown that our scheme lead to a reduction of complexity in terms of time slots for SNR estimation when the number of the transmit antennas are more than two. Monte Carlo simulation results of outage probability are presented to demonstrate its advantage over the other two conventional TAS schemes.
